Appeal to the Bangladeshi Community

My name is Ben Wilson and I am a 4th year occupational therapy student from the University of Newcastle. I am currently involved in a project which involves depicting occupations in an international context. For the content of this work I have chosen to focus the work of Dr Mohammad Yunus and the Grameen bank in Bangladesh.

My aim is illustrate how the use of microcredit has had a positive effect on well-being for many people throughout Bangladesh, particularly women.

Further to this, the project involves a visual representation of our chosen issue through an artwork that will be displayed in the university gallery.

It is my wish to incorporate into this artwork actual Bangladeshi Taka, however so far I have been unsuccessful in sourcing any through foreign exchange companies. As a result, I am appealing to the Bangladeshi community in Australia in anticipation that you may be able to be of assistance. I fully intend to purchase these notes and simply require assistance in sourcing them. Any help would be greatly appreciated.
